The world's best-selling, most authoritative guide to OpenGL programming has now been completely updated to reflect all the latest enhancements in OpenGL Version 1.2, the high-performance standard used by today's hottest graphics hardware. The authors -- all of them members of the OpenGL Architecture Review Board -- begin with an in-depth explanation of OpenGL fundamentals: 3-D drawing, color, lighting, and beyond. They cover essential OpenGL graphics programming techniques for blending, fog, working with bitmaps, fonts, and much more. Next, they move on to advanced topics including texture mapping -- the technology behind much of today, most exciting 3D work. The book contains detailed coverage of Version 1.2's most exciting new features, plus extensive information on the new routines and capabilities built into Versions 1.3 of the OpenGL Utility Library and OpenGL Extension to the X Windows system. Thousands of graphics programmers already recognize OpenGL Programming Guide as the one OpenGLbook they simply must own -- and they'll find this new Third Edition even more indispensable.
